When it comes to THC vape cartridges, one question comes up all the time: How long does a THC cart actually last?
The truth is—it depends. The lifespan of your vape cart varies based on its size, oil type, and how often you use it. For example, a standard 1-gram THC cartridge can give you around 160 to 320 puffs, depending on your draw length and voltage settings.

Before talking lifespan, let’s cover the basics.
A THC vape cartridge (often called a “cart”) is a small glass tank filled with cannabis oil that attaches to a vape pen or 510 thread battery. Inside, there’s a coil that heats the oil into vapor when you inhale.

Several factors determine how long your THC cartridge will hold up. Let’s look at what makes the biggest difference — and how to get the most out of every gram.
This one’s obvious. A casual user who takes a few puffs after work will make a cart last weeks. A heavy user vaping throughout the day might go through a 1g cartridge in just a few days.
The longer and deeper your pulls, the faster you’ll burn through oil.
Quick, gentle puffs = more lifespan. Long drags = thicker clouds but faster emptying.
It’s all about balance — find your rhythm.
Here’s a rough estimate of how long different THC vape cart sizes last:
| Cartridge Size | Approx. Puffs | Typical Duration (Moderate Use) |
|---|---|---|
| 0.5g | 80–160 | 3–5 days |
| 1g | 160–320 | 1–2 weeks |
| 2g | 320–640 | 2–4 weeks |

Not all cannabis oils are created equal.
High-quality oils — especially live resin — offer richer flavor and stronger effects, but since they’re terpene-rich, they might vaporize slightly faster.
Distillates, on the other hand, are more refined and longer-lasting but often have a simpler flavor profile.

Your vape’s voltage setting can make or break your cart’s lifespan.
Higher voltage = bigger clouds but faster oil consumption.
Lower voltage = smoother flavor and longer-lasting oil.
If your vape has adjustable voltage, keep it between 2.5V–3.3V for the best balance.
THC oil is sensitive to light and heat. Storing your vape pen or cartridge in direct sunlight, a hot car, or near heat sources can degrade the oil faster.
Keep it upright in a cool, dark place to preserve flavor and potency.
